Richard Devon
Richard Devon was a performer from the United States, celebrated primarily for his acting work in both movies and TV shows.
Biography
Career
Born in Glendale, California, Devon built up an extensive resume in television. Among his many TV appearances were shows like The Rifleman, The Virginian, Daniel Boone, The Monkees, Lassie, the 1962 The Twilight Zone episode titled "Dead Man's Shoes," and Mission: Impossible. He also voiced the character of Batman for the unaired pilot of a Batman radio show. In film, Devon appeared in the 1957 horror picture The Undead, War of the Satellites, The Three Stooges Go Around the World in a Daze, and The Battle of Blood Island. He also contributed voice acting to Ewoks.
Death
On February 26, 2010, Devon passed away in Mill Valley, California, due to vascular disease.
